An asset is a resource owned by an individual or organization which provides economic value. This includes cash, equipment, property, rights, or anything that helps a company generate revenue or reduce expenses. According to the International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S), assets are obtained as a result of past transactions or events ...

Last Update: March 22, 2024. The Federal Reserve Board of Governors in Washington DC.Nov 18, 2021 · Assets are any resource of value that is owned by an individual, business, or government. Assets are categorized as short-term (current) assets and long-term (fixed) assets. Current assets are already cash or more easily converted to cash than fixed assets, which usually have a lifespan of more than one year. We'll also introduce you to BlueTally, an asset ...The ROA formula is: ROA = Net Income / Average Assets. or. ROA = Net Income / End of Period Assets. Where: Net Income is equal to net earnings or net income in the year (annual period) Average Assets = (Starting Total Assets + Ending Total Assets) / 2. The accounting equation displays that all assets are either financed by borrowing money or paying with the ...Fixed asset examples. Fixed assets are purchased for long-term business use. These items are also referred to as property, plant, and equipment, or PP&E. Examples include: Land and buildings. Equipment. Furniture and fixtures. Heavy machinery. Hardware and, in some cases, software. Tools. shop the avenue Assets should provide a company with consistent returns.
